How to Choose the Right Gym in Hood River for Your Fitness Journey
Choosing the right gym is a crucial step in your fitness journey. With various options available in Hood River, OR, finding a gym that aligns with your goals, preferences, and lifestyle can make all the difference in achieving your fitness objectives. Here’s a guide to help you navigate the selection process and find the perfect fit for your needs.
1. Define Your Fitness Goals
Before you start exploring gyms in Hood River, OR, take a moment to clearly define your fitness goals. Are you looking to lose weight, build muscle, improve endurance, or enhance overall health? Your goals will significantly influence the type of gym you should consider.
Weight Loss: If your primary goal is weight loss, look for gyms
that offer a variety of cardio machines, weight training equipment, and group
classes focused on high intensity workouts.
Muscle Building: For those aiming to build muscle, seek out gyms
that provide free weights, resistance machines, and personal training services.
General Fitness: If you want a well-rounded approach, consider gyms that offer a mix of cardio, strength training, and flexibility classes.
2. Consider the Gym's Location
The gym's location plays a vital role in your commitment to regular workouts. Ideally, you want a gym that is conveniently located near your home or workplace. This proximity can significantly reduce barriers to attending workouts.
Accessibility: Consider traffic patterns and parking availability.
A gym that’s easy to access will encourage you to stick to your routine.
Environment: Visit the gym to assess its atmosphere. Does it feel welcoming and comfortable? A positive environment can motivate you to come back regularly.
3. Assess Facilities and Equipment
Take the time to evaluate the gym's facilities and equipment. Different gyms cater to various fitness styles, so ensure they have what you need.
Equipment Variety: Look for a gym with a wide range of equipment,
including cardio machines, free weights, and resistance training machines.
Space: Check the layout of the gym. Is there enough space for group
classes, stretching, and floor workouts? A crowded gym can hinder your
experience.
Amenities: Consider additional amenities such as locker rooms, showers, saunas, and childcare services. These features can enhance your gym experience, making it more convenient and enjoyable.
4. Explore Class Offerings
If you enjoy group workouts, investigate the types of classes offered by the gym. Many people find that group fitness classes keep them motivated and accountable.
Class Variety: Look for a gym that offers a diverse schedule of
classes, including yoga, spinning, HIIT, Zumba, or martial arts. Variety can
keep your workouts exciting and help you avoid plateaus.
Qualified Instructors: Ensure the classes are led by certified and experienced instructors who can guide you through proper techniques and modifications.
5. Check Membership Options and Costs
Gym membership fees can vary widely, so it’s essential to find a gym that fits your budget without compromising quality.
Membership Plans: Review the different membership options
available, including monthtomonth plans, annual contracts, and family packages.
Some gyms may offer discounts for students, seniors, or military personnel.
Trial Period: Consider gyms that offer a free trial or day pass. This allows you to test the facility and its classes before making a longterm commitment.
6. Evaluate the Community and Culture
The community and culture of a gym can significantly impact your motivation and enjoyment. A supportive environment can encourage you to stay committed to your fitness journey.
Community Events: Check if the gym organizes events, challenges, or
social gatherings. Participating in community activities can enhance your sense
of belonging.
Member Demographics: Observe the gym's clientele. Are there people of various fitness levels? A diverse community can make you feel more comfortable, regardless of your starting point.
7. Seek Recommendations and Reviews
Word-of-mouth recommendations and online reviews can provide valuable insights into the gyms you’re considering.
Personal Recommendations: Ask friends, family, or coworkers about
their experiences with local gyms. They may have valuable insights or even
workout partners to join you.
Online Reviews: Check online platforms for reviews of the gyms you’re considering. Look for common themes, both positive and negative, to gauge the overall reputation of the gym.
8. Trust Your Instincts
Finally, trust your instincts.
After you’ve done your research and visited potential gyms, listen to your gut
feeling. You should feel comfortable, motivated, and excited about working out
in your chosen gym.
